Handy Pantry Friendly Food Stores at a glance
What we know about Handy Pantry Friendly Food Stores
The first Handy Pantry Food Store opened in 1976. Over the past 38 years this family owned and operated business has grown to 11 locations serving the Suffolk County community from the north shore to the south shore. Our stores offer a high level of customer service, and help you avoid the long lines at the supermarket. Our Deli department offers premium meats & cheeses, freshly prepared salads, and prepared breakfast and lunch sandwiches. We brew fresh coffees and teas at our Tea & Coffee bar all day. Handy Pantry also offers dairy products, groceries, to-go-meals, produce, frozen foods, beer, and more. If you have any comments, questions or concerns please let us know.

Autonomous Inventory Replenishment and Waste Reduction Agent
For a multi-site operator like Handy Pantry, balancing fresh deli inventory with shelf-stable goods is a constant challenge. Over-ordering leads to spoilage and waste, while under-ordering causes lost revenue and customer frustration. Traditional manual ordering processes are prone to human error and fail to account for hyper-local demand spikes caused by weather or local Suffolk County events. Automating these replenishment cycles ensures optimal stock levels across all 11 locations, directly protecting margins in the high-spoilage deli and produce categories.
AI-Powered Labor Scheduling and Compliance Agent
Managing 200-500 employees across 11 locations requires balancing labor costs against peak service hours. In New York, labor regulations and wage pressures make inefficient scheduling a significant financial drain. An AI agent can optimize shift patterns to match predicted customer traffic, ensuring that the deli and coffee bar are fully staffed during morning rushes without overstaffing during lulls. This stabilizes labor costs while maintaining the high level of customer service Handy Pantry is known for.
